Output 19da1aae09549dfd0475b78f90d94d4b78c43df922a9979c190d56bef0def96f:20

value
66087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0df33c20c161f24d2d159c9c7f3a5d4c0c61db1 OP_EQUAL
address
3LjRroaFcKBh6JA4jzQJE64KDMpCHFoo4H
transaction
19da1aae09549dfd0475b78f90d94d4b78c43df922a9979c190d56bef0def96f
confirmations
152
spent
true